**Responsibilities**
- Greet patients and visitors in a friendly and professional manner, ensuring a positive first impression of the office.
- Manage front desk operations, including answering multi-line phone systems, answering inquiries and scheduling appointments.
- Maintain accurate electronic medical records (EMR) like Oscar, Clinic Aid, and experience in LFP Billing
- Assist with billing and insurance verification processes.
- Support clinical staff by preparing patient charts and assisting with administrative tasks as needed.
- Utilize software systems such as Oscar, Clinic Aid and LFP Billing.
- Handle billing invoices, inquiries, assist with insurance verification processes billing for Private, WCB, ICBC and extended Health insurances
- Provide support in medical office tasks, including patient check-in and check-out procedures. Ex: Taking vital signs (i.e. Blood Pressure, Heart Rate, Height and Weight, etc.) on each patient and recording in electronic medical records.
- Preparing examination rooms, setting up and maintaining medical supplies and equipment for all examinations and procedures. Cleaning and sterilizing the clinic, materials and instruments ( working knowledge of Autoclave).
- Checking inventory and ordering medical supplies and materials
- Assisting the Doctors with minor procedures (i.e. pap tests, removal of stitches, ear flush)
- Ensure compliance with medical terminology and office protocols to enhance patient care.
- Opening and Closing procedures.
